$57.60. The tax is 7.5%. What is the tax amount for this meal?

Respuesta :

GoddessofDork
GoddessofDork GoddessofDork
  • 24-09-2018

To find the tax amount, you would multiply $57.60 by 0.075 (7.5% in decimal form).

[tex]\$57.60\times 0.075=\$4.32[/tex]

The tax for this meal is $4.32.
